Transaction 85231a623d12f78991e4c3a5485ea86615b382631cb8116da2741c62bbbc80e6
1 Input
1 Output
-
85231a623d12f78991e4c3a5485ea86615b382631cb8116da2741c62bbbc80e6:0
- value
- 18000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ad086f5cb0d27f5717f0e8fed0196449c09fab3 OP_EQUAL
- address
- 38WbjTmCebmR87tQkT735NzWmRfjpMEmnV